as I said, I just went into lockdown with the chicks, and I'm having problems. The humidity is staying around 73 after I added all the water, is this fine for hatch? If not how do I lower it?
 
73 is absolutely fine. I hatch with higher humidity for my quail. The only time humidity is an issue is if it's high at the beginning of incubation and the eggs don't lose enough moisture. The chicks then don't have enough oxygen to sustain them in the air cell until they make an external pip (they don't drown - they suffocate). Make sure you have your vents open and your babies should be just fine. Good luck!
